This three-bedroom detached home is beautifully designed with the space and layout perfect for family life.
From the moment you step inside it feels like home. With wall panelling, engineered oak flooring and a storage cupboard for all those things you need to keep close to hand.
On the left you’ll find a beautifully bright living area. It’s a room that feels nice and modern without compromising on character. A wood burner, bay window and built-in shelving makes it a comfortable space to unwind at the end of a long day.
Let’s talk about the kitchen-dining room. The heart of the home and a peachy spot to relax and entertain. Deep blue storage cupboards, wooden worktops and plenty of natural light means you can cook up your favourite dishes in style. If you’re someone who likes a glass of vino whilst they cook, then the wine cooler is a great addition.
There’s an island to make those busy mornings stress-free and French doors that open out onto the garden for when you need to stretch your legs. Whether you’d like a dining table or a snug area like the current owners, it’s ready to become a space that suits you best.
A utility, downstairs loo and store cupboard helps to keep things practical.
On the first floor there are three bedrooms, two of which are doubles but all benefit from their own built-in storage space. Bedrooms one and two are extra special, sage green wall panelling and beautifully designed, they both feel like your own retreat. One is incredibly bright with a window seat under the huge bay window, whilst the other has a modern ensuite for an extra layer of privacy.
What makes this one extra peachy? The well-loved, landscaped rear garden. With a mix of lawn, patio, sleepers, bordered edges and raised beds ready for planting, it’s a top spot for hosting summer soirees and making the days last as long as possible.
You’re in the right place with Lawns park and Lawn Primary School just a short walk away. Old town is only 15 minutes by foot, meaning you can have a good mooch in the local shops or enjoy a nice summer stroll to one of your favourite restaurants.
